Fold-up kayak goes from trunk of your car to the water in minutes

By Stephen Regenold Special to Outdoors

The sheet of plastic is scored and notched, an intricate pattern that folds tight and packs up box-shape to fit in a backpack. Undo the package, crease the material at its flex points and fasten the straps. Soon, a kayak will emerge.
